What Is Intercom?

Intercom is a customer messaging platform that allows businesses to communicate with their customers across various channels such as email, live chat, and in-app messaging. The platform integrates customer support, marketing, and sales into a single interface, making it easier to track, respond to, and engage with users in real time.

With tools that range from chatbots to product tours, Intercom is built to enhance customer experiences while automating repetitive tasks, such as ticket routing and frequently asked questions (FAQs). The goal is to make customer interactions smoother, faster, and more personalized.

What Are Intercom’s Features?

  • Live Chat and Messaging: Intercom provides customizable live chat widgets that allow real-time communication with users. It supports various messaging formats, including in-app messages and emails.
  • Automation: The platform includes support bots that utilize machine learning to provide automated responses, helping to resolve common customer inquiries quickly.
  • Customer Engagement Tools: Intercom offers tools for user onboarding, product adoption, and feedback collection, making it easier for businesses to understand and support their customers effectively.
  • Integrations: It integrates with over 300 applications, enhancing its functionality and allowing businesses to streamline their workflows
  • Analytics and Reporting: The platform provides detailed analytics and reports on customer interactions, helping businesses understand customer behavior and the effectiveness of their communication strategies.

Is Intercom Free to Use?

Intercom does not offer a completely free plan. However, it provides a limited free usage option and a free trial.

Intercom Free Trial

Intercom offers a 14-day free trial that does not require a credit card to sign up. During this trial, users can access all features of their chosen plan, including Proactive Support Plus and unlimited usage of the Fin AI Copilot.

After you finish the free trial, Intercom does offer a limited free version, but the core features that make it a powerful tool for businesses are locked behind paid plans. The free version, known as Intercom’s “Starter” plan, includes basic live chat and limited audience segmentation. However, most businesses will find that to unlock the platform’s full potential—including advanced automation, segmentation, and integrations—they’ll need to upgrade to a paid plan.

Here’s a breakdown of Intercom’s pricing plans:

Intercom Starter Plan

  • Price: Free for small teams
  • Features: Basic live chat, outbound messaging, and basic audience segmentation.
  • Best for: Small startups and businesses that need basic customer communication features.

Intercom Growth Plan

  • Price: Starting at $74/month
  • Features: Advanced live chat, email support, product tours, and custom bots.
  • Best for: Growing businesses that want to scale their customer support efforts.

Intercom Accelerate Plan

  • Price: Custom pricing based on business needs
  • Features: More robust automation, greater customization, and detailed reporting.
  • Best for: Large enterprises that require comprehensive customer support solutions.

What Are Intercom’s Limitations? 

While Intercom offers a wide range of features that are best for businesses of all sizes, it has main drawbacks, such as functionality issues and pricing concerns.

Cons of Intercom

Details

Buggy Search Function

The search feature for support tickets is often laggy or freezes, making it difficult to find relevant information quickly.

Confusing Navigation

The user interface is not intuitive, requiring significant time to learn where features are located.

Slow Support Response

Ironically for a customer service platform, Intercom's own support team has been noted for slow response times.

Expensive Add-ons

Essential features like Product Tours and Analytics are only available as costly add-ons, significantly increasing the overall price.

Limited Mobile Compatibility

While core features work on mobile, the Product Tours add-on is only compatible with desktop platforms.
